Heim  >  Artikel  >  Web-Frontend  >  Wie entferne ich das Höhenattribut eines Elements mit jQuery?

Wie entferne ich das Höhenattribut eines Elements mit jQuery?

WBOY
WBOYOriginal
2024-02-28 08:39:041072Durchsuche

Wie entferne ich das Höhenattribut eines Elements mit jQuery?

Wie entferne ich das Höhenattribut eines Elements mit jQuery?

Bei der Frontend-Entwicklung müssen wir häufig die Höhenattribute von Elementen manipulieren. Manchmal müssen wir möglicherweise die Höhe eines Elements dynamisch ändern, und manchmal müssen wir das Höhenattribut eines Elements entfernen. In diesem Artikel wird erläutert, wie Sie mit jQuery das Höhenattribut eines Elements entfernen, und es werden spezifische Codebeispiele bereitgestellt.

Bevor wir jQuery zum Bedienen des Höhenattributs verwenden, müssen wir zunächst das Höhenattribut in CSS verstehen. Das Höhenattribut wird zum Festlegen der Höhe eines Elements verwendet und kann über ein CSS-Stylesheet festgelegt werden. In einigen Fällen müssen wir möglicherweise das Höhenattribut eines Elements über JavaScript dynamisch ändern oder entfernen.

Schauen wir uns zunächst ein einfaches Beispiel an. Angenommen, wir haben eine HTML-Struktur wie folgt:

<div id="myElement" style="height: 100px;">这是一个有固定高度的元素</div>

Wir können jQuery verwenden, um das Höhenattribut dieses Elements durch den folgenden Code zu entfernen:

$(document).ready(function(){
   $("#myElement").css("height", "");
});

In diesem Code verwenden wir zuerst $(document).ready() -Funktion, um sicherzustellen, dass die Seite geladen wird, bevor der Vorgang ausgeführt wird. Dann wählen wir das Element mit der ID „myElement“ aus und verwenden die Methode css(), um sein Höhenattribut zu entfernen. In der Methode css() setzen wir den Wert des Höhenattributs auf einen leeren String, damit das Höhenattribut des Elements entfernt werden kann. $(document).ready()函数来确保页面加载完毕后再执行操作。然后我们选中id为"myElement"的元素,并使用css()方法来移除其高度属性。在css()方法中,我们将height属性的值设为一个空字符串,这样就可以将该元素的高度属性移除。

除了上面的方法,我们还可以使用removeAttr()方法来移除元素的高度属性。示例如下:

$(document).ready(function(){
   $("#myElement").removeAttr("style");
});

在这段代码中,我们使用removeAttr()方法来移除元素的style属性,这样就可以将包括高度在内的所有样式属性都移除。

总的来说,使用jQuery来移除元素的高度属性是非常简单的。我们可以通过css()方法将具体的属性值设为一个空字符串,也可以使用removeAttr()

Zusätzlich zur oben genannten Methode können wir auch die Methode removeAttr() verwenden, um das Höhenattribut des Elements zu entfernen. Ein Beispiel ist wie folgt: 🎜rrreee🎜In diesem Code verwenden wir die Methode removeAttr(), um das Stilattribut des Elements zu entfernen, sodass alle Stilattribute einschließlich der Höhe entfernt werden können. 🎜🎜Insgesamt ist es sehr einfach, das Höhenattribut eines Elements mit jQuery zu entfernen. Wir können die Methode css() verwenden, um den spezifischen Attributwert auf eine leere Zeichenfolge zu setzen, oder wir können die Methode removeAttr() verwenden, um das gesamte Stilattribut zu entfernen. In praktischen Anwendungen können Sie eine geeignete Methode auswählen, um das Höhenattribut eines Elements entsprechend den spezifischen Anforderungen zu bedienen. 🎜

Das obige ist der detaillierte Inhalt vonWie entferne ich das Höhenattribut eines Elements mit jQuery?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n